MANILA, Philippines - It’s an open fact that the Philippines and Thailand have a long and deep relationship with each other. To make this bond even stronger, a special night of Thai culture and fashion, spearheaded by the Tourism Authority of Thailand, was held recently at The Conservatory, Manila Peninsula. Gracing the exclusive celebration were two important figures – Khun Kanokkittika Kritwutikon, director of the Tourism Authority of Thailand, and Ambassador Thanatip Upatising of the Embassy of Thailand to the Philippines. Indeed, it was a special occassion to celebrate the Colors of Thailand.

The evening started with a gracious cocktail spread of Thai cuisine canapés and desserts welcoming guests from the diplomatic community, business and society. Guests also got to witness the exhibit highlighting Thai fashion and food just before they entered the main Conservatory area.

A short program was hosted by none other than Manila’s top party denizen Tim Yap helped to vivify the event. Likewise, Khun Kanokkittika Kritwutikon shared the spotlight and gave a few words on the night’s stellar offering. Photos by Mike Amoroso
